This is Sokoban implemented by following @iolivia's Rust sokoban tutorial — but in Bevy instead of ggez.
This is literally my first experience in gamedev, so the code is probably not very idiomatic and/or clean — all feedback is very much appreciated!
NB: At the moment of writing Bevy is still at the very early stages of development. Please consider contributing or donating :)